Poetry. THE MEAN GAME--John Wall Barger's fourth book-length entry in what might be called, collectively, a savage comedy--bristles with allegories that explore human cruelty and suffering. Gathering narratives that feel both ancient and modern, Barger forges an apocalyptic vision without sacrificing poetry's underlying sense of joy, humour and revelation. Part comic book translated from a dead language, and part nightmare dreamscape, THE MEAN GAME is a must-read from one of Canada's most kinetic writers.

When George finds a way to escape the spacecraft Artemis, where he has been trapped, he is overjoyed. Surely now he can return to Earth. But when George touches down, he knows immediately that something is wrong. There’s a barren wasteland where his home town used to be, intelligent robots roam the streets, and no one will talk to George about the Earth that he used to know. With the help of an unexpected new friend, can George find out what – or who – is behind this terrible new world, before it’s too late?

Who said all unicorns have to be good? Xavier isn't like other unicorns. He's got attitude and the tongue to match. But that attitude gets him kicked out of Unicaria, the secret part of the forest where all the unicorns live. With nowhere to go, Xavier wanders for days until he is befriended by a young man and woman from a nearby village. Together, they accidentally uncover an evil wizard's plot to invade Unicaria and kill all the unicorns. When no one believes their story, they take matters into their own hands and embark on a quest to save the unicorns - and unknowingly, the world. Bad Unicorn is a standalone fantasy novel that tries not to take itself too seriously. Follow Xavier as he adjusts to the humanoid world while trying to save everyone he's ever known. Filled with fun and adventure, humor and horror, this book will change the way you look at unicorns forever.

Massive Federation armies invade Alcea through magical portals seeking to devastate the entire continent. Outnumbered four to one, the Alceans grimly prepare for the bloody conflict, but victory on the battlefield is not good enough for young King Arik. Knowing that the Great Demon has initiated the war between the two countries solely to provide a million tears to fulfill an ancient prophecy, King Arik demands that the Knights of Alcea spare as many of the enemy soldiers as they can. While defeat on the battlefield means death for the Alceans, a victory that allows the Great Demon to fulfill the ancient prophecy will mean eternal servitude to Alutar.
